Gissons Arms Poltergeist
The Gissons Arms in Kennford is a hotspot for paranormal activity, with reports of a mischievous poltergeist causing quite a stir. This former landlord seems to have a strong presence, particularly in the evenings, when lights flicker on and off, doors creak open, and music starts playing on its own. Patrons have also caught whiffs of a burning smell wafting through the bar, only for it to vanish a minute or two later. And if that's not enough, some folks have spotted the face of a small blonde girl peeking out of the window towards the car park.

The Murdered Maid of Exeter
Lord Haldon Hotel, Exeter
Deep in the heart of Exeter, the historic Lord Haldon Hotel stands tall, its elegant facade hiding a dark secret. This is the haunting place of a tragic young maid who met her untimely demise within these very walls. Her story is one of love, betrayal, and murder. The maid, who remains unnamed, fell pregnant after an affair with a local landowner. In a desperate attempt to cover up the scandal, the landowner brutally took her life. Now, her spirit is said to return to the top of the building, a dripping wet apparition, forever trapped in a moment of terror and despair.

Tapping Ghost of Haldon House
Haldon House, Dunchideock
Haldon House in Dunchideock is home to a mischievous spirit known as the Tapping Ghost. This ghost has been named as a son of a former owner who grew tired of the lad. His raps and taps have been reported many times over the years, and his faceless head and shoulders have also been reported. The strange occurrences are said to be a manifestation of the son's restless energy, a result of being neglected by his family. Mamhead Obelisk Horse Ghost
Area around the obelisk, Mamhead
In the rolling countryside of Mamhead, Devon, there's a spot where the ordinary and the unexplained seem to converge. It's here, near the historic obelisk, that a rather unusual ghostly encounter has been reported. A witness, out walking her dogs on a crisp October day in 2009, suddenly felt and heard the unmistakable sound of a large horse trotting towards her. She quickly moved her dogs to one side, expecting a rider to pass by, but when she turned around, there was no one there.
